ID:322993

牛马先生 有团队

全栈开发工程师

  • 公司信息:
  • 中科信息安全共性技术国家工程研究中心有限公司
  • 工作经验:
  • 4年
  • 兼职日薪:
  • 500元/8小时
  • 兼职时间:
  • 下班后
  • 周六
  • 周日
  • 可工作日远程
  • 可工作日驻场(离职原因)
  • 可工作日驻场(自由职业原因)
  • 所在区域:
  • 北京
  • 海淀

技术能力

- 熟练掌握Java ,有扎实的编程功底,具备良好的编码规范,熟悉面向对象和数据结构,阅读过Jdk相关源码;
- 熟练使用Spring,SpringMvc,Mybatis/Mybatis-Plus,SpringBoot,SpringCloud/Alibaba等相关框架,对底层工作原理有一定的理解,并阅读过Mybaits,Spring相关源码;
- 熟练使用Mysql,Redis,Mongodb等数据库,并了解其原理,有集群搭建相关经验;
- 熟练使用阿里分布式开源框架Dubbo + Zookeeper应用程序协调服务,了解Dubbo底层实现,并对Netty有一定研究;
- 熟练使用FastDFS,MinIO,阿里云OSS等分布式文件存储服务;
- 熟练使用Linux系统,Nginx,Docker等相关运维技术;
- 熟悉RabbitMQ,Kafka等消息中间件;
- 熟悉ElasticSearch搜索引擎;
- 熟练使用Arthas,JMeter等相关JVM调优工具;
- 熟练使用Vue2/3,UniApp,JQuery,ElementUi,AVue,IVue,Echarts等前台技术;
- 熟练使用ChatGPT,并有相关接口调用经验,熟悉SSE协议;
- 熟练掌握 Python、Golang 等编程语言;
- 熟悉爬虫工作原理,熟练使用Scrapy/Scrapy-Redis、WebMagic爬虫框架;
- 熟悉Js反爬机制和调试技巧,使用逆向工具分析定位接口并给出解决方案;
- 熟悉Selenium、Appium、Fiddler相关工具的使用;
- 了解Python Web框架(Django、Flask、Tornado、FastAPI);
- 了解Go语言Web框架Beego;

项目经验

项目一: 信息安全综合服务平台
开发环境: Win11/Jdk11/Idea/Git/Maven/Node
项目架构:
SpringCloud/Alibaba+SpringBoot+SpringSecurity+MybatisPlus+Mongodb+Mysql+Redis+Mi
nio+Activiti7+Nginx+Vue2/3+ElementUi+Echarts+Uniapp
项目介绍: 随着信息技术的飞速发展,信息安全问题日益凸显。为了满足企业和个人在信息
安全领域的需求,我们推出了"信息安全综合服务平台"项目。该项目旨在为用户提供集成的
信息安全解决方案,涵盖项目管理、流程管理、激活码管理、文档管理、报价管理、权限管
理、订单管理以及定时任务等功能,以便用户更好地管理和保护其信息资源。
责任描述:
1.微服务技术调研及平台框架搭建
2.ABAC、RBAC权限模型设计及开发
3.项目管理需求分析及功能开发
4.低代码流程管理功能开发
5.文档管理功能开发
6.报价管理、订单管理、许可证管理等功能开发
技术描述:
1.本系统采用微服务架构,同时采用多种数据库实现不同场景的数据存储
2.使用RBAC权限模型作为系统的基础权限,使用ABAC权限模型作为项目管理,文档管理
等模块的数据操作权限
3.使用Activiti7、Mongodb、FormCreate实现低代码可配流程管理
4.文档管理针对常用分布式文件管理系统阿里云、华为云、亚马逊、Minio统一封装,并
设计为动态可配置项,针对Minio实现了断点上传/下载功能,可实现文件存储在企业内部,
并能快速高效上传大文件
5.使用XXL-JOB实现定时数据同步功能
6.使用腾讯云短信、邮箱实现用户工作任务提醒
7.采用Uniapp实现移动端订单支付页面开发


项目二: OA管理系统升级与优化
开发环境: Win11/OpenResty/Lua/Vscode/Node
项目介绍: 本项目旨在对现有的OA管理系统进行全面升级与优化,以提高办公自动化、信息
流程管理和工作效率。OA(Office Automation)管理系统是一个关键的企业工具,它涵盖了
员工管理、日常办公、审批流程等多个方面,有助于公司更加高效地运营和管理。
责任描述:
1.登录功能升级为扫码登录
技术描述:
1.原本使用SSLVPN代理需要输入两次用户名口令,现升级为扫码登录,采用OpenResty作
为OA代理服务器,针对登录请求,退出请求等进行拦截转换为扫码登录相关页面,采用
Lua+Redis实现二维码数据信息以及用户数据信息的存储


项目三: 国家科技管理信息系统监督平台-科研空间
开发环境: Win10/Jdk1.8/Idea/Git/Maven/Tomcat/Nginx
项目架构:
SpringBoot+MybatisPlus+SpringSecurity+Redis+ElasticeSarch+RabbitMq+FastDFS+WebMa
gic爬虫
项目介绍:根据科技监督评估工作安排,监督司提出国家科技监督信息平台建设工作,监督信
息平台是国家科技管理信息系统的重要组成部分,将支撑科技监督、评估评价、科研诚信等
业务工作,科研空间主要为监督信息平台收集科研人员的信息资料,该系统包含海量的科研
人员期刊数据。该系统分为WEB端和小程序端,功能包含:基本信息,个人经历,科研情况等。
责任描述:
1.爬虫框架的搭建,实现知网,WOS,期刊数据的动态抓取
2.爬虫框架集成Elasticesarch+RabbitMQ+FastDFS基于此技术实现爬虫数据的存储
3.基于AOP+非对称加密协议,封装加密注解,实现自动加密,自动解密
4.学科领域功能开发
5.个人经理模块的功能开发
6.学术领域,学术任职,专利详情功能开发以及对共服务平台对接

团队情况

  • 整包服务: 微信公众号开发   微信小程序开发   PC网站开发   H5网站开发   App开发   WebApp开发   其他开发   
角色 职位
负责人 全栈开发工程师
队员 前端工程师
队员 后端工程师

案例展示

  • 信息安全综合服务平台

    信息安全综合服务平台

    随着信息技术的飞速发展,信息安全问题日益凸显。为了满足企业和个人在信息安全领域的需求,我们推出了"信息安全综合服务平台"项目。该项目旨在为用户提供集成的信息安全解决方案,涵盖项目管理、流程管理、激活码管理、文档管理、报价管理、权限管 理、订单管理以及定时任务

  • 密码应用安全性评估工具

    密码应用安全性评估工具

    为贯彻落实《中华人民共和国密码法》相关精神,满足信息系统密码应用建设过程中对商用密码应用安全性评估工作(以下简称“密评”)的要求,工程中心在对密评测评标准、测评方法、测评技术和测评流程不断研究基础上,将测评实施过程与技术研发相结合,研发“密码应用安全性评估工具”。 本产品适

查看案例列表(含更多 0 个案例)

信用行为

  • 接单
    0
  • 评价
    0
  • 收藏
    0
微信扫码,建群沟通

发布任务

企业点击发布任务,工程师会在任务下报名,招聘专员也会在1小时内与您联系,1小时内精准确定人才

微信接收人才推送

关注猿急送微信平台,接收实时人才推送

接收人才推送
联系聘用方端客服
联系聘用方端客服